Output fcc8125c69103e634314345cbd037c08d6797858158279d911fae64106f33b54:94

value
12706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d18eda66acf93c757d5046f140a59fd106e653f5ee32ffc69ce9d96d1ea1708
address
bc1pe5vwmfn2e7fuw474q3h3gzjel5gxuefltm3jllrfe6wed502zuyq07ct7x
transaction
fcc8125c69103e634314345cbd037c08d6797858158279d911fae64106f33b54
spent
true